Office F, 102a Longstone Road, Eastbourne, East Sussex, BN21 3SJ
Office F, 102a, Longstone Road, Eastbourne, East Sussex, England, BN21 3SJ
Office E, 102a Longstone Road, Eastbourne, England, BN21 3SJ
98c Longstone Road, Eastbourne, United Kingdom, BN21 3SJ
102d Longstone Road, Eastbourne, England, BN21 3SJ
Popular Companies
Latest Companies
Copyright © 2024. All rights reserved.